Fermented grass carp inoculated with four different starter cultures(Pediococcus acidilactici,Lactobacillus-Lo3,Lactobacillus-B5407 and Lactobacillus sake) were evaluated for physicochemical properties and proteolytic changes in this work.The result showed that grass carp muscle inoculated with starter cultures resulted in a rapid pH decrease from 6.25 to 5.06~5.40,but the control group was 5.98 during the 2 days fermentation.The TBA and TVB-N values was significantly lower than the contrl group(P<0.05) and rising slowly.Moreover,a few slight changes in proteolytic and increase in free amino acids was detected during fermentation,free amino acids increased significantly and extensive hydrolysis of the sarcoplasmic proteins and myfibrillar proteins occurred during storge.The proteolysis of inoculate groups was significantly more than control group,the groups of Pediococcus acidilactici and Lactobacillus-B5407 were the most.
